About Zoran Đurić
Zoran Đurić is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Rehabilitation and Human-Computer Interaction, having authored 47 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Vision and Imaging (7 papers), Stroke Rehabilitation and Recovery (6 papers) and Advanced Steganography and Watermarking Techniques (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(946 citations), Human-Computer Interaction (56 citations) and Media Technology (75 citations). Zoran Đurić has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Bosnia and Herzegovina and Israel. Frequent co-authors include Azriel Rosenfeld, Sushil Jajodia, Harry Wechsler, S.J. McKenna, Neil F. Johnson, Nasir K. Memon, Neil F. Johnson, Yiannis Aloimonos, Lynn H. Gerber and Miguel Ángel Sotelo.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Pattern Recognition and International Journal of Computer Vision.
